> Consider the following text: > ----begin example---- > --- > --- >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et, consectetur adipiscing elit, sed do > --- > --- > ----end example----- > > With auto-fill mode on, continuing to type on the "Lorem ipsum" > line results in the following: > ----begin example---- > --- > --- > Lorem ipsum dolor sit amet, consectetur adipiscing elit, sed do > ---eiusmod asdf > --- > ----end example----- > > Notice how "eiusmod" does not start on a new line, as would be > expected. I don't think this is specific to Org mode. Text mode behaves the same. The prefix for the current paragraph is "---". Regards, -- Nicolas Goaziou
